Wawens start preparations for NSL

Sports

MOROBE Wawens have kicked off preparations for the upcoming Kumul Petroleum National Soccer League season with selection trials at the Lae Football Association Park.
The trials which started yesterday will end tomorrow before a squad is selected for the 2019-2020 campaign.
Franchise owner Andrew Namuesh told The National that the purpose of the trials was to identify new talent for the squad.
Namuesh said 60 Mamose players had being selected to participate in the trials.
The participating players are from Wewak, Madang, Bulolo, Finschhafen, Nawaeb, Huon Gulf and Lae.
“The team will be trimmed down to 23 players for the season,” he said. “The onus is on the players to perform as we do not want a biased selection or do not want to see the management interfering with the process. The selection must be on merit and whoever is selected will be in the final squad with the coaches having the final say on the players selected and not the management.”
Namuesh said some players from Wewak and Madang were yet to arrive for the trials.
“Training for the final squad will start once we know when the season gets underway,” he said.
